** The general auto repair market in and around Fulton, Michigan, is characteristic of a rural area. The options within the city limits of Fulton itself are very limited, with Fulton Service Center being the primary local provider. This means residents often look to nearby towns like Battle Creek, Nashville, and Hastings for auto service. The competition level is moderate, with a handful of established, long-standing shops dominating the market in the broader region. The average quality of service is high, as these businesses survive on reputation and word-of-mouth in a close-knit community. Pricing is generally competitive and often considered reasonable and fair compared to larger urban centers, with a focus on value and building long-term customer relationships rather than high-volume, low-margin work.

What are the most common auto repairs needed for vehicles in the Fulton, MI area?

Due to our rural roads, seasonal temperature swings, and winter road salt, common repairs include brake work (from rust and wear), suspension components like ball joints and shocks (from rough roads), and exhaust system corrosion. Battery failures are also frequent during cold Fulton winters.

How can I find a reputable and trustworthy auto repair shop in Fulton?

Start by asking neighbors or local community groups on social media for personal recommendations, as word-of-mouth is strong in a small community. Also, look for shops with long-standing histories in Fulton and certifications like ASE, which indicate a commitment to quality and training.

Are auto repair prices in Fulton typically higher than in larger cities like Grand Rapids?

Generally, labor rates in Fulton can be very competitive, often lower than in major metro areas. However, for some specialized repairs, local shops may need to order parts, which can add time, though pricing for common repairs and maintenance is usually quite reasonable.

When should I seek service for a check engine light around Fulton?

Seek service promptly, as driving on rural routes or M-37 with an unresolved issue could lead to a breakdown far from help. Many Fulton-area shops offer a quick diagnostic check to determine if it's an urgent issue related to emissions, sensors, or engine performance.

What local factors should I consider when scheduling maintenance in Fulton?

Schedule pre-winter checks in early fall for your battery, brakes, and tires to handle snowy conditions on county roads. Also, plan around local farming seasons if you share the road with heavy equipment, as this may increase the need for alignments or windshield chip repairs.
